Koirala addresses nation; uges Terai people for dialogue
Kathmandu, Jan 31 (UNI) Prime Minister Girija Prasad Koirala in his address to the nation has asked the agitating Terai people to stop the agitation and come for talks with the government in order to resolve the unrest in the Terai region.
Mr Koirala said there was no alternative for talks to solve any type of problem and urged Madheshi people to come for talks and appealed to the countrymen to exercise restraint and contribute towards creating a new Nepal.
''The federal structure of the nation will be created during the formation of new constitution after the election to the constituent assembly,'' Mr Koirala said, adding that the number of constituencies will be increased in accordance with the existing population in each district. The present 205 constituencies will remain unchanged.
He said the Home Minister has been directed to solve the current problem.
More than half a dozen people have been killed in Terai of Nepal due to the violence since the second week of January.
